Fake police nabbed by Crime Branch, uniforms, equipment recovered

Mumbai, Mar 15 : A 28-year-old man has been arrested by the Crime Branch Unit X for allegedly cheating people by assuring them government jobs in various department in
Mantralaya, BMC and other offices.

Receiving several complaints against the 'fake policeman', the Crime Branch swung into action and
formed the special team to nab the accused.

According to Crime Branch sources, after going through prior investigations, they figured out that the accused was using a 'POLICE' tag (sticker) on his bike and car. They also discovered that he had committed similar crimes in Oshiwara in February and in MIDC in March.

In both cases, he cheated the unsuspecting people with the assurance that he will help them in securing government jobs and to obtain BMC licenses.

On Tuesday the police received reliable information about a man using a police tag on his vehicles.

They also received information that he would visit Aarey colony, Andheri, Dindoshi and its adjoining area regularly.

Acting on a tip-off, the police laid a trap near Sanjay Gandhi Society in Goregaon (E) and detailed the accused, Sagar Walmiki (alias Rakesh).

Upon searching his car, Crime Branch officials found a police constable's cap, a police belt and fake
documents which he was using to cheat people.
Through interrogation, it was learnt that, he had cheated more than 22 people until date of more
than 10 lakhs in total.

He was produced before the court on Thursday and sent to police custody.
